Overview

Jesús Balsinde is affiliated with the Spanish National Research Council in Spain. Their research primarily focuses on biochemistry, genetics, and molecular biology, with notable contributions in medicine. The main subfields of study include molecular biology, biochemistry, immunology, surgery, and nutrition and dietetics.

Their research topics emphasize lipid metabolism and biosynthesis, peroxisome proliferator-activated receptors, sphingolipid metabolism and signaling, cholesterol and lipid metabolism, fatty acid research and health, cancer related to lipids and metabolism, and liver disease diagnosis and treatment.

Jesús Balsinde has published extensively across various scientific journals. Frequent publication venues include Biomolecules, Biomedicines, Journal of Hepatology, Cells, and Biomedicine & Pharmacotherapy.
